This part of the standard replaces the previous editions are. --- GB/T 22148-2008.IntroductionCISPR15.2005 clearly defines the radio frequency disturbance limits lighting requirements, but only regarded as finished and scheduled to run Lighting equipment end-user market and make provision, for example, lamps, self-ballasted fluorescent lamps and stand-alone electronic control device. Intend to install No part in the fixture emission requirements. Most lamps (tubular fluorescent lamps, low-voltage halogen lamps or HID lamps) electronic control unit are installed in different types of lamps, Not only it is installed in a different manufacturer's lamps, and is installed in the same manufacturer of different types of fixtures. Although the data can predict some type of harassment in other lighting fixtures measured with the same electronic control unit and lamp, but the These lamps should still be tested. This begs the question, we can design a test fixture for the worst-case installation test electronic control device, in this case Under conditions of the test lamps meet the requirements, then the contents of the electronic control unit for all lamps meet the requirements, you can avoid a lot of unnecessary Test. The idea seems to be correct, simple and fun, but it leads to two opinions. Lamps --- worst case too strict. It found that the electronic control unit mounted in the worst lighting conditions can not pass from a Forecasting Through certain tests, but in actual lamps through. --- Even if the electronic control unit mounted on the fixture in the worst case by the trial, there is still a problem, if the electronic control Means mounted within the actual lighting does not meet the requirements, who will be responsible. It is not appropriate to change CISPR15.2005 Basic Principles on the built-in lighting means no emission requirements. However, within the radio spectrum necessary for a separate test to detect electronic control device performance. It is independent and describes the use of an electronic control device in special lights type of testing arrangement. This separation will be published in order format In future revisions and modifications. When Recognizing the need, it will increase the corresponding additional requirements. Single-ended and double-ended fluorescent lamps with electronic control unit1 ScopeGB/T his part of the CISPR15 T 22148.2005 requirements, corresponding to the reference on the basis of the use of the lamps, a detailed description Independent Test Method Ⅰ class and/or class Ⅱ radio disturbance characteristics of fluorescent lamps with an electronic control device. This section covers the use G5 or G13 lamp double capped fluorescent lamps and 2GX7,2G8,2G10,2G11,2GX13, G23, GX23, Single-ended G24q, GX24q, GR8 and GR10q fluorescent lamp electronic control unit. Note. The above list includes only some typical for the lamp, and the lamp are not all represented. This section applies specifically to devices connected to the 220V/50Hz power supply network. CISPR15.2005 A1.2006 A2.2008 Limits and side of radio disturbance characteristics of electrical lighting and similar equipment Method (Limitsandmethodsofmeasurementofradiodisturbancecharacteristicsofelectricallightingand similarequipment)3 to determine complianceIf the electronic control unit and the corresponding reference lamp connected in line with CISPR15.2005 Table 2a and the terminal voltage limits Table 3a, Table 3b or Table B.1 radiation disturbance limits, then considered to comply with CISPR15.2005 Radio disturbance limits. When the electronic lamp The control device by an external device control, control terminal disturbance voltage shall comply with CISPR15.2005 in Table 2c limits. Load terminal Disturbance voltage limits do not apply. However, it should be noted that the reference was not a lamp fixture reference lamps use the worst case does not accurately reflect the actual lighting Performance. Built-in test the electronic control unit of the actual lighting, not directly considered to meet the CISPR15.2005 requirements. For EMC compliance, luminaire manufacturers should also consider Chapters 6 and 7 of this section, and a control device lamp manufacturer Installation instructions. Test Method 4 Follow the instructions in Chapter 5, the electronic control device is mounted within the reference lamps. When the electronic control unit is designed to drive more than one lamp, all lamps should work simultaneously. Reference lamps should be in accordance with CISPR15.2005 test method for measuring the 8.1,9.1 and 9.2 (or Appendix B) described above. The test shall use an electronic control device is designed to match the lamp.
